Spaces:
Running
Running
Refactor conversation deletion logic: Simplify annotation file path handling by reducing the number of paths considered for deletion.
Browse files
app.py
CHANGED
|
@@ -856,13 +856,7 @@ def delete_conversation_from_huggingface(conversation_id):
|
|
| 856 |
# Учитываем разные варианты пути к аннотациям
|
| 857 |
annotations_base = os.path.basename(DATASET_ANNOTATIONS_PATH)
|
| 858 |
annotation_paths = [
|
| 859 |
-
f"{annotations_base}/annotation_{conversation_id}.json"
|
| 860 |
-
f"{annotations_base}/evaluation_{conversation_id}.json",
|
| 861 |
-
f"annotations/annotation_{conversation_id}.json",
|
| 862 |
-
f"annotations/evaluation_{conversation_id}.json",
|
| 863 |
-
f"evaluations/annotation_{conversation_id}.json",
|
| 864 |
-
f"evaluations/evaluation_{conversation_id}.json",
|
| 865 |
-
f"{chat_dir}/evaluations/evaluation_{conversation_id}.json"
|
| 866 |
]
|
| 867 |
|
| 868 |
for annotation_path in annotation_paths:
|
|
|
|
| 856 |
# Учитываем разные варианты пути к аннотациям
|
| 857 |
annotations_base = os.path.basename(DATASET_ANNOTATIONS_PATH)
|
| 858 |
annotation_paths = [
|
| 859 |
+
f"{annotations_base}/annotation_{conversation_id}.json"
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 860 |
]
|
| 861 |
|
| 862 |
for annotation_path in annotation_paths:
|